Best 25 CDs of 2005 !

After Forever -
Remagine
 

 

Avian-
From the Depths of Time

Brainstorm -
Liquid Monster
Circle II Circle -
The Middle of Nowhere
Circus Maximus -
The 1st Chapter
Cloudscape -
Cloudscape
Communic -
Conspiracy in Mind
Epica -
Consign to Oblivion
Kamelot -
The Black Halo
Lydian Sea -
Architect of Humanity
Machine Men -
Elegies
Masterplan -
Aeronautics
Morgana Lefay -
Grand Materia
Nevermore -
The Godless Endeavor
Nocturnal Rites -
Grand Illusion
Overlorde -
Return of the Snow Giant
Pagans Mind -
Enigmatic:Callling
Primal Fear -
Seven Seals
Rob Rock -
Holy Hell
Secret Sphere -
Heart and Anger
Thunderstone -
Tools of Destruction
Tribuzy -
Execution
Suspyre -
The Silvery Image
Vision Divine -
The Perfect Machine
 
Zero Hour -
A Fragile Mind
 

+2 BONUS Russell Allen related albums (non Power/Prog):

A melodic metal/rock record, with these two premier vocalists collaborating it is indeed a treat to be heard!




Russell Allen & Jorn Lande -
The Battle

 

A mostly late 70's hard rock influenced CD, which has Russell singing in a soulful grittier style.  It brings back great memories of this style of rock music for those who know it, and for others is an introduction that is awesome!


Russell Allen -
Atomic Soul
